One of the biggest things I've heard in this thread, and irl, is that "I don't pay for my friends". Make no mistake about it, I don't, nor did I when I was involved with Beta, pay for any of the friends I made. In fact, a year or so before I graduated from UGA I started making the distinction between my friends who were brothers and the people that were brothers. Not all of the 70 some odd people that walked through the Beta house's doors were my friends.
If anyone is willing to pay the dues to become a member of any nationally recognized organization, then that person is doing basically the same thing as joining a fraternity. Sure, most organizations don't require applicants to learn the history of the organization and what not, but the two acts (joining a frat or, say, becoming a SCCA member) are essentially the same. The individual is paying dues to a central organization for the "exclusive" right to gain some benefit from that organization.
In the case of social fraternities, one should theoretically be joining an organization where there is some common bond. I pledged Beta at SMU and affiliated at UGA because the guys in the house were all different in many ways but still socialized and had a good time. The character of each house is different, and that's why there are so many of them.
